vacation packages through platforms like Expedia, Vrbo, Booking.com and Priceline. Both companies benefit from global travel demand and strong digital ecosystems. They have a similar business model centered on aggregating online travel information, with revenues mainly generated from commissions on bookings. This makes both companies highly scalable and closely aligned with travel trends. Comparing them now is relevant as global travel demand remains strong. Per Technavio analysis, the travel market is expected to grow rapidly in the coming years, creating significant opportunities. With this context, both EXPE and BKNG are well positioned — but the key question is which stock offers better upside potential. Let's find out. The Case for EXPE Stock Expedia Group operates in a favorable global travel market, supported by sustained demand across both leisure and international segments.
